The New York Islanders just seem deadset on losing games. Last night, despite two separate leads, including one in the third period, the Islanders lost to the Seattle Kraken in a shootout, falling to 0-5 after regulation and 5-6-5 overall, which is just an absurd record 16 games into the season.
Their PK is historically bad right now, and it's obvious why: They're just letting guys whip the puck around. There is no pressure, no sticks in lanes, and bad clears when they get a chance. And now, they're all playing like they're afraid to make a mistake, goaltenders included-although I would say it's probably not Ilya Sorokin and Semyon Varlamov's faults that the Islanders are 0-4-3 in their last seven.
